This month’s theme is ‘Frame in Frame Composition’. Look for natural or architectural frames like doorways, windows, arches, mirrors, tree branches that surround or highlight your subject. Use these elements to guide the viewer’s eye and add depth to your image.
Focus on strong outlines and clean edges to emphasize form within the frame. Shoot during sunrise or sunset when the soft, golden light enhances contrast and brings out textures. Remember, the frame itself can tell a story and add meaning to your subject.
